#1 Wed 01 May 2019 17:46
- dpierred19
- Juste Inscrit !
- Date d'inscription: 4 Mar 2019
- Messages: 7
Runtime Error ArcGis / binascii
Salut à tous,
J'utilise en ce moment un outil sous ArcGis développé en Pyhon. Mon problème est le suivant :
J'ai besoin de la fonction binascii.hexlify dans ce script, j'importe donc la bibliothèque binascii en début de script.
Lorsque je lance mon outil je rencontre alors une Runtime Error. J'ai cependant remarqué qu'en enlevant la ligne import binascii je n'avais plus de Runtime Error mais le programme s'arrête logiquement à la ligne de mon scipt utilisant la fonction "binascii.hexlify"
J'ai donc 2 questions :
1) Est ce possible que le simple fait d'importer la bibliothèque binascii provoque le "Runtime Error" de mon script? J'ai pourtant bien testé d'importer la librairie binascii dans la console Python et cela fonctionnait. Ma version Python est la 2.7 et je bosse sur ArcGis 10.6
J'ai tenté de désinstaller/réinstaller toutes les librairies Microsoft Visual C++ sans succès.
2) Si l'import de binascii provoque le Runtime Error, pour pallier ce problème je cherche à remplacer dans mon script la ligne suivante : u=binascii.hexlify(os.urandom(6))
Je cherche donc à trouver une ligne de code effectuant la même opération sans utilisation de binascii.hexlify, pour l'instant sans succès. Auriez-vous une idée?
Merci par avance pour votre aide!
Bonne journée/soirée!!
Pierre
Hors ligne